I come bearing notes and lineup changes for tomorrow's 3p.m. Xavier game.
IU (7-13) will meet Xavier (10-6) in a reunion of former IU assistants Tracy Smith and Scott Googins. The two were both assistants in former IU coach Bob Morgan's dugout during his most successful season. In 1996, Morgan's squad IU won the Big Ten tournament championship and made it to the NCAA Regional -- the last time IU accomplished either feat.
Googins has been with Xavier for four years, turning the upstart team into a formidable opponent. The Musketeers beat NC State and Michigan State in reaching their 10-6 record. More than a simple reunion, the Xavier game is a pivotal one for IU's Big Ten season.
A meeting Minnesota awaits this weekend, starting a portion where IU will have to play better and come up with big wins if it has any plans of playing into May or June.
Lineup changes
The game will feature a couple of changes in the left side of the infield, as Jake Dunning will get the nod at third base and Tyler Rogers moves into shortstop.
Squires (1-1) will start his third game of the season. At practice yesterday, he said the game could be huge for morale heading into Friday against the Gophers and Big Ten play. Check tomorrow's edition of the IDS for more coverage and quotes for the Xavier game.
